Hi people,

 

I ran into some battery/ electrical problems with my FZ1' year 02.

 

Some months ago, when I flick on the hi-beam, the dash(speedo/ trip...etc) will die off and come on again in an instant. I checked the old battery, it is not doing very good.

Making barely 11.6+-V while idling and no more than 12.4 or so when being revved. (More or less, cant really remember)

Anyway, I changed the battery but still the problem remains.

 

Last week, the battery stopped charging and culprit was the coil.

With the new coil, the battery is going at 13.6V while on the move and 12.6V at idle. Good.

But the problem is, sometimes for no reasons when the bike idle for say 1-2 minutes after a 30 minutes ride, the volt will drop down to 11.5 or lower, then the dash(speedo/ trip...etc) will do it's on-off nonsense again.

 

Any ideas guys?

 

By the way, how often do the coolant need to be flushed? I am thinking is it the heat that is causing the problem.

 

Thanks

 

Bro... i think ur rectifier lah. Or another reason you may have some exposed wiring that u may not be aware which kena the heat may melt. Try go HL or any good bike shop ask them to do the point check. Good luck bro... Do update us. We all learn frm one another... :angel:

Posted (edited)
owner manual will tell you to do valve clearance at 42 000 km...good to do valve clearance and timing chain and tensioner change at one go...you need not do it at HL, any good bike shops should be able to do it for a fraction of the price the authorised agent quoted.

 

politically yes. Skip at your own risk... Dun blame the bike if something happens or the engine gets noisier cos you have a choice...

 

Doing the valve clearance ensures that your engine is quieter and that combustion is optimum...
